使用Drupal还原备份站点

时间:2015-05-04 15:48:44

标签: php mysql drupal backup wamp

我正在尝试从Drupal中active_page模块制作的副本中恢复备份网站,我按照以下步骤操作:

  1. 将drupal文件复制到www目录
  2. 创建一个新的mySQL数据库
  3. 使用新的db
  4. 安装drupal
  5. 启用备份和迁移模块
  6. 执行了恢复
  7. 我遇到了这个错误:

    Backup and Migrate

    这个问题是由#34;备份和迁移"的开发版本解决的。模块。

    在使用dev版本创建备份并使用相同版本(dev)在主机中恢复之后,我得不到任何结果,没有任何内容被更改我的网站仍然是处女,而Notice: Undefined index: files in theme_backup_migrate_file_list() (line 954 of .../sites/default/modules/backup_migrate/backup_migrate.module) 中没有任何内容。

    可能缺少设置可能是问题原因:

    1. 数据库设置:我有相同的设置(数据库名称,表格前缀......)

    2. php.ini admin/reports/dblog,我的备份文件是126M

    3. 已启用Appache模块memory_limit = 128M

    4. 请提供任何有用的提示。我不知道我在这里失踪了什么。

1 个答案:

答案 0 :(得分:1)

我的建议是:

  1. 将文件复制到www

  2. 使用phpMyAdmin或类似工具创建空数据库并导入转储B& M创建。

  3. 更改/sites/default/settings.php以连接到新数据库。

  4. 登录后端并查看配置 - >媒体 - >文件系统都是写入drupal的必要路径。只需单击“保存配置”,如果没有任何字段获得红色边框,则表示没问题。如果有人那么你必须改变dir访问标志(所有者,无论如何)以使这些dirs可写。